(3 Credit Hours) ENG 131 (Honors) is the first college-level composition course in a twosemester sequence, emphasizing critical reading, critical thinking, and critical writing skills. Through readings, students will explore various topics and various types of writing. Through essays, written in and out of class, students will demonstrate the development of a clear main idea through well-organized supporting material, written in correct, effective English. To meet the above goals, a writing assignment integrating analysis and summary of an article and a persuasive paper synthesizing multiple sources will be included. This assignment will focus on a theme related to the Honors Colloquium topic. Prerequisites: A satisfactory score on the English placement test or a grade of S (Satisfactory) in ENG 092 or ENG 093, and a grade of S (Satisfactory) in ENG 081, if required.
